Output 981b8215d97b4edbc0360174010f87d23d5ec7e38248598d11c387cec086baf1:107

value
264936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99f0e0af84f8c2997a3a369440b286fe9a4814d OP_EQUAL
address
3L56HRhmWwKXzhVrBkbHsnyNMaJzhyqBZy
transaction
981b8215d97b4edbc0360174010f87d23d5ec7e38248598d11c387cec086baf1
spent
true